#4993ab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4993ab is composed of 28.6% red, 57.6%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.3% cyan, 14%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 194.7 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 47.8%. #4993ab color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#002757.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#4993ab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030506 is the darkest color, while #f7fb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4993ab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787b7c is the less saturated color, while #07b5ed is the most saturated one.
